I know the tranny takes in 2 qts of fluid, however, i only put in 1.75 qt and it started spillling when i lowered the car. After it stopped spilling i put in the filler nut. Do you think my tranny has enough fluid in it??? I led it drain at least 2 hours or so lowered on the ground.

I know the tranny takes in 2 qts of fluid, however, i only put in 1.75 qt and it started spillling when i lowered the car. After it stopped spilling i put in the filler nut. Do you think my tranny has enough fluid in it??? I led it drain at least 2 hours or so lowered on the ground.
if it spills out the top hole, then its full. the mobil gear oil is for your differetial, what did you put in the tranny?
